Specialized equipment coming for children with disabilities

Children with special needs will have more opportunities to play when some new technologies arrive at child development centres throughout the province this month.

CanAssist at the University of Victoria worked with the BC Association for Childhood Development and Intervention and CDC staff to select technologies that would be most useful for children with special needs.

The technology includes an accessible gaming controller so children with limited hand function can use popular video-gaming systems, and a ball launcher, which allows children who are unable to throw independently to play ball with others and with pets.
